# Onboarding: PruneBot

PruneBot deletes branches with no commits in 90 days across Marrowfield repos. Reviewers: check its dry-run output in the #prunebot channel before approving config changes. Runtime config lives in /etc/prunebot/bot.env. DRY_RUN, GRACE_DAYS, and EXCLUDE_PATTERN are documented in the repo wiki and safe to discuss openly. The bot also needs a repo-admin token to delete refs. That token's line goes immediately after this sentence.

secret setting of yagef-baweg: RELAY_SECRET29=cb53deb59a49ed54d9f43599b54ca

## Environment variables: tracing (Mosswire platform)

Request tracing across Mosswire microservices uses the Threadline collector. Each service sets TRACE_SAMPLE_RATE and TRACE_COLLECTOR_URL; spans propagate via the x-threadline-context header. For the security review: trace payloads exclude request bodies by default, and PII scrubbing runs in the collector before storage. Services authenticate to the collector with a shared write credential, declared in the env file on the line that follows.

vault entry, yahif-yajep: COURIER_KEY29=b802bdf8034096b65a51c6ba5abe2

## Runbook: Websocket Compression on Brindlegate

Quick context for support: Brindlegate's websocket gateway can compress frames per-message, which cuts bandwidth a lot for chatty dashboard clients but chews CPU under load. If customers report lag during peak hours, the usual suspect is compression fighting with the small-frame workloads — tiny payloads get slower, not faster. Don't toggle anything yourself; escalate to on-call instead, and include the gateway's current settings in the ticket. Right now production runs with the following.

settings of kagup-tagug:
ULAIX_HOST=ulaix.zemvarsys.internal
ULAIX_PORT=8000

First responder should check the geocoder pool in the Tilemark cluster before restarting anything — most incidents last quarter were stale cache shards, not the service itself. If a restart doesn't clear it within fifteen minutes, escalate to the Maps Platform team lead, currently Priya on the Harrowgate side. For anything involving customer data corruption, skip the rotation entirely and reach the escalation desk directly.

pager mailbox: druwyn@norvaio.corp